Standard Chartered Ultimate Credit Card

Standard Chartered Ultimate Credit Card is a premium credit card offering multiple benefits to cardholders. It makes you avail of discounts on traveling, lifestyle, and dining. The card is equipped with world-class privileges for the Standard Chartered Bank Ultimate Credit Cardholder.

The eligibility criteria to apply for Standard Chartered Ultimate Credit Card

  • The minimum age to apply for a credit card is 21 years and the maximum is 65 years.
  • The minimum income requirement for salaried is Rs 2 Lakh per month.
  • The minimum income requirement is Rs 24 Lakh per annum.
  • Must be having a credit score of 750, or above.

Features and benefits of Standard Chartered Ultimate Credit Card

  • Earn 5 Reward points on each Rs 150 spent. Avail of maximum benefit with 1 reward point of Re 1.
  • Get 6000 reward points as welcome bonus points of joining fee
  • Up to ₹ 10,000 cashback on MakeMyTrip if booked within 90 days of card issuance
  • 2% foreign currency markup fee on overseas spends
  • 5% cashback on duty-free spends
  • Free airport lounge access to over 1000 across the world with a complimentary Priority Pass Membership with certain terms and conditions applied.
  • Travel and Air Accident Cover of up to $200K and Medical Travel Insurance of up to $25K.
  • Get 20 premier golf courses membership in India and 150 worldwide. 1 complimentary game and 1 complimentary coaching session per month

Standard Chartered Ultimate Credit Card fees and Charges

Fees and Charges Amount
Annual Fee Rs 5000
Renewal Fee Rs 5000
Cash Advance Charges 3% of withdrawal or Rs. 300 per transaction, whichever is higher
Add-on fee per annum NIL
Over-Limit Charges 2.5% of overlimit amount subject to a minimum of Rs. 500
Surcharges Rs. 10 or 1% of the transaction (whichever is higher) are levied on Petrol transactions. Rs. 25 or 2.5% (whichever is higher) are levied on Railway station
Goods and Services Tax GST is levied on all taxable supplies
Late Payment Charges Rs. 0 for statement outstanding balance less than or equal to Rs. 100
Rs. 100 for statement outstanding balance between Rs. 100 and Rs. 500
Rs. 500 for statement outstanding balance between Rs. 501 and Rs. 5,000
Rs. 700 for statement outstanding balance between Rs. 5,001 and Rs. 15,000
Rs. 800 for statement outstanding balance greater than Rs. 15,000
